Superphosphate
Encyclopedia : S : SU : SUP : Superphosphate
Superphosphate is a fertilizer produced by the action of concentrated sulfuric acid on ground phosphate rock.
- Ca3(PO4)2 + 2H2SO4 → Ca(H2PO4)2 + 2CaSO4
